On Sat, 6 Jan 1996, Richard J Uren wrote: > Hey Matt - You'll need to add options to your kernel. > I'm not sure about the messaging tho. Yep, I discovered this right after I sent the message. I thought I had compiled this stuff in, but I guess I didn't. > Bad system call is probably an effort to grab/alloc some shared memory. > > options SYSVSHM # Shared Memory > options "SHMMAXPGS=1536" # 6M (1536 4k pages) sh memory > options SYSVSEM # semaphores > options SYSVMSG # messaging > Thanks, and have a good one. | Matthew N.
